The Power of Compaction: Asphalt Rollers at Work
When it comes to paving projects, achieving proper compaction is crucial for durability and longevity. Asphalt rollers play a vital role in this process, densifying the asphalt mixture into a smooth and sturdy surface. These specialized machines use heavy weights to transfer pressure, forcing out air pockets and seating the aggregate particles together.
- Several types of asphalt rollers are available, each designed for specific tasks.
- Vibratory rollers are commonly used to achieve optimal density.
- For larger projects, tandem and triple axle rollers offer increased force for efficient compaction of the asphalt.
Proper operation of an asphalt roller is essential for achieving a well-compacted surface. Engineers must adjust factors such as speed, pressure, and passes to ensure optimal results.
